Output eb16447bfb96139dd6b9ffa3813da51103014cd94d0e57882965df4a99784fcc:1

value
53473436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b2e035da9fb1e12e347b805402fe465a7dafbdf OP_EQUAL
address
3LDLDXyePdWALkTrGHGbFaTarub41F7eQa
transaction
eb16447bfb96139dd6b9ffa3813da51103014cd94d0e57882965df4a99784fcc
confirmations
300275
spent
true